Laos Records 9,372 Dengue Fever Cases in First Nine Months of 2025

07/10/2025 10:11
KPL Laos has reported a total of 9,372 dengue fever cases, including one death, from January to September 2025, according to the Ministry of Health.

In its report released on Monday, the ministry stated that the highest number of infections was recorded in the capital, Vientiane, with 4,738 cases. Oudomxay Province followed with 1,034 cases, while Vientiane Province reported 693.

The single fatality occurred in Vientiane Capital, where health authorities remain on high alert.

In response to the ongoing outbreak, the Lao government has urged health officials and medical staff across the country to strengthen the management and monitoring of dengue fever cases to prevent a wider spread.

The Ministry of Health also confirmed it will continue working closely with development partners to reduce the incidence of dengue. The public is being urged to stay vigilant, take preventive measures, and help limit the risk of further infections.
